I drive a getz. Used to get around 13km/l. I pump SPC92 80% of the time. Then the last few months, it was dropping to 11~12km/l.

The only thing I have added was an amp and a subwoofer. Didn't know if that was the cause.

 

I was looking for fuel system cleaner anyway and read good things about Redline. Techron concentrated, I couldn't find.

Then I tried it for a small dosage. And the first tankful, it went back up to 13km/l and the 2nd tankful was still close to 13km/l - haha..might be just dirty fuel system.

I was kind of surprised bcoz I was not looking to improve fc. [:)]
